GUBBIO – Today, Friday 8th July, the 1st edition of the “Internazionali di tennis maschile Città di Gubbio”, a futures tournament with a prize money of 10000$ was presented with a press conference in which all the most important institutions such as the major of Gubbio Filippo Stirati, the councillor Gabriele Damiani, the tournament director Luca Ceccarelli, the representative of the Italian Tennis Federation Roberto Carraresi, the president of “MEF tennis events” Marcello Marchesini have participated.
The press conference was introduced by Andrea Migliarini, the manager of “MEF tennis events” who highlighted that Umbria is the region with Marche that organise more professional tournaments of tennis: “This project started 10 years ago with the Todi challenger and we are happy that also Perugia and Gubbio host two important tournaments of tennis.

Umbria is a privileged region because the tournaments take place in beautiful cities of art which have unique landscapes and player are fascinated to play here”. The president of “MEF tennis events” Marcello Marchesini said that he strongly believes in the connection between tennis and tourism and the results confirmed his idea and he keeps believing in this beautiful project because the sport tourism encourages the growth of Umbria.
The major and the councillor of Gubbio are sure that this event is a breakthrough for the city. In particular the major affirmed: “In our growth strategy, sport is an important part because it is a social, cultural and promotional fact. It is also an incentive for the tourism of the city. Organising these events is a challenge for us in the field of organization, competence and welcome.
This could be a strong element of growth in the public and private professionalism. We want to exalt our city in this particular moment of difficulty for the municipalities, moment that is less known by people and politics. The councillor want to point out that this tournament belongs to a tourism strategy focus on sport and the engagement of the institutions for this event”.

Roberto Carraresi, the representative of the Italian Tennis Federation in Umbria highlighted once again the importance of the tournament for Gubbio and for Umbria: “Umbria is one of the most important Italian region in the field of tennis because we organise three professional tournaments for adult tennis players, one important youth tennis tournament and other 120 activities during the year.
Since 2004 the number of tennis members have grown significantly: 12 years ago the members were 1400, while now we have 5200 members. Among them there are a lot of young promising tennis players. It is also important having the support of private sponsors and public institutions to organize these important events”.

At the end, the tournament director Luca Ceccarelli declared that the his only certainty was that everybody agreed the idea of this tournament: “The most important aspect is that we were able to create an organising committee which allows us to organise everything as well as possible. In the week of our tournament, other nine tournaments were scheduled all over the world, but we have the highest level of players.
I would like to thank Cantiano that make available a training camp for the players. I want to remember that this tournament will take place in memory of Francesco Ledda who would have made a good impression if he had played here”.
